Add the following binary numbers, show your work:101101 + 111000100100 + 1100111111 + 1110110110101 + 1011011111101001 + 1101101001101 + … WebMar 19, 2024 · Solution: 2’s complement of 11010 is (00101 + 1) i.e. 00110. Hence. Minued - 1 0 1 1 0. 2’s complement of subtrahend - 0 0 1 1 0. Result of addition - 1 1 1 0 0. As there is no carry over, the result of subtraction is negative and is obtained by writing the 2’s complement of 11100 i.e. (00011 + 1) or 00100. Hence the difference is – 100.

Step 1: Write down the binary number: 111011. Step 2: Multiply each digit of the binary number by the corresponding power of two: 1x2 5 + 1x2 4 + 1x2 3 + 0x2 2 + 1x2 1 + 1x2 0. Step 3: Solve the powers: 1x32 + 1x16 + 1x8 + 0x4 + 1x2 + 1x1 = 32 + 16 + 8 + 0 + 2 + 1. Step 4: Add up the numbers written above: ness wadia bca admission
